Using linkage analyses of family members, highly significant associations were established between the genes encoding the thick ascending limb (TAL) transporter, SLC12A1 ( Simon et al., 1996a ), KCNJ1 ( Simon et al., 1996b ) and CLCNKB ( Simon et al., 1997 ) in Bartter syndrome, which were named as Bartter syndrome type I, type II and type III, respectively.
